We’ve already had a glimpse at the wacky, college-set goings-on promised by Pixar’s latest sequel, Monsters University. But the company has, as usual, been fairly quiet on the plot. Now Entertainment Weekly has gotten Billy Crystal – the wisecracking voice behind cycloptic beastie Mike Wazowski – to open up just a little on the story.

While the trailer showed off life in the dorms, and the fact that Mike and future BFF Sulley (John Goodman) didn’t exactly start out the best of friends, Crystal has spilled some info about what will happen in the movie. Don’t read the next paragraph if you’re looking to stay entirely spoiler-free, but there are only minor details to be found.

“Mike and Sulley end up in the same fraternity where they have this scare competition — like Greek Games in college,” says Crystal. “They have to mobilize a group, sort of like Revenge Of The Nerds-monsters, and get them ready to be scary.”

According to Crystal, the duo are still very much freshmen in the film – around 17 / 18. So don’t expect much crazy, drunken behaviour…

With Dan Scanlon directing, Monsters University is due out here on July 12, 2013. Check out that first trailer below.
